5 Army Soldiers Killed After Vehicle Catches Fire In Poonch

INS Desk by INS Desk
April 20, 2023
A A
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terWhatsappTelegramEmail

Poonch, April 20: Five army soldiers were killed after a vehicle they were travelling in caught fire in Poonch district on Thursday.

Official sources said that the incident took places in Bhatadhurian area of Mendhar Sub Division in Poonch this afternoon.

“Today, at about 1500 hours, one vehicle of Indian Army, while moving from Bhimber Gali to Sangiot in District Poonch (J&K), caught fire. In this tragic incident five soldiers of Indian Army have lost their life,” defence ministry spokesperson based in Jammu said. “Further details are being ascertained.”

While army statement was silent about reasons, sources said that investigations are underway if the incident happened due to grenade or thundering as it was heavily raining in the area.
